3.4.7 LED Indication
A Status LED is available only for the base board (082U, 008U, 000U) and the daughter board
(3COIDB, 1PRIDB) does not have the status LED, therefore a Status LED on base board is used in
common about LED indication related to the daughter board.

The order of priority (No.1 ~ 8) is set up to each status and when more than one different status are
occurred, the highest priority LED indication pattern (status) will be indicated. Refer to Table 2-19 PRI
LED Indications.
Table 2-19 PRI LED Indications
Priority
No.
Operation Status
LED Indication on the
Base Board
Remarks
1
System Initializing
On
2
The assignment of the board is refused.
3s On / 3s Off
When you exceed the
system capacity.
When the main soft-
ware version is not
matched.
3
Trouble found during self-diagnostics.
1s On / 1s Off
4
Normal
Operation
A Channel is busy (use another from CH1 ~
CHx).
500ms On / 100ms Off
5
All channels are idle.
100ms On / 100ms Off
6
Board
Busy
A Channel is busy (use another from CH1 ~
CHx).
100ms On / 2s Off
7
All channels are idle.
Off
8
Downloading firmware.
80ms On / 80ms Off /
80ms On / 80ms Off /
80ms On / 400ms Off
